The purpose of this study is that this research discusses the review of Islamic law on the impact of buying and selling thrift goods in Gorontalo City . As for the objectives of this research are: to find out how the review of Islamic law on the impact of buying and selling thrift goods in Gorontalo City. This study uses empirical legal research methods. Empirical legal study itself is a study that views law as a reality, including social reality, cultural reality, and empirical studies of the world. This research took place at the Saturday and Sunday Markets in Gorontalo City. The results obtained from this study are that in Islamic law the practice of selling is not in accordance with one of the pillars and conditions of the contract, namely Ma'qud alaih (object), because the goods are not clearly specified. Sellers and buyers do not know clearly the quality of goods with certainty or gharar. Therefore, this thrift sale and purchase is included in the ghajr sahih fasid contract because one of the pillars is not fulfilled and ghair shahih , a vanity contract because it is not clearly specified so that it does not have a legal impact.
